• ベストアンサー

MDBの排他制御

こんにちわ。 いまACCESS2000をデータベースにして,VBでクラサバ構成を実現しようと しています。 そこで2つのプロセスから同時にMDBのあるテーブルを更新しようとすると,ロック状態になってしまいます。 MDBでこのような状態を回避するのはどうすればよいでしょうか? 教えてください。 よろしく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• O_cyan
  • ベストアンサー率59% (745/1260)
回答No.2

Accessのオプションの詳細にある[既定のレコードロック]はどのようになっていますでしょうか。 レコードレベルでロックしてひらくのチェックの有無は。 下記のURLを参照してみてください。 http://www.microsoft.com/japan/developer/library/off2000/vbaac/acproRecordLocks.htm http://www.microsoft.com/JAPAN/developer/library/vbaac10/acproRecordLocks.htm

参考URL:
http://www.microsoft.com/japan/developer/library/off2000/vbaac/acproRecordLocks.htm
tatsurou
質問者

お礼

O_cyanさん 回答ありがとうございました。

その他の回答 (1)

noname#182251
noname#182251
回答No.1

VBからMDBにどのように接続しているか不明ですが、いずれにせよあるテーブルの全レコードに対しロックを掛けることはできるはずです。

tatsurou
質問者

お礼

fuuten_no_nekoさん 回答ありがとうございました。

関連するQ&A